Wafer Probing is an electrical testing process conducted on semiconductor wafers after the integrated circuits are applied to the wafers. This is an essential step in the semiconductor manufacturing process that helps to determine the functionality of wafers and overall production quality. Thin film deposition is a process used to create thin film coatings on different materials. Thin films can consist of metal, semiconductors, and dielectrics, providing them with different properties. These properties translate to benefits such as electrical insulation, optical transmission, and corrosion resistance, that can be used to improve substrate performance.
